Creamy Baked Macaroni and Cheese

Overhead shot of bubbly baked mac and cheese, golden breadcrumbs dusted across the top and cheesy sides.
Baked Macaroni and Cheese with Breadcrumbs
By Fiona Caldwell
This recipe relies on a classic roux based mornay sauce to ensure a creamy texture that never turns oily or grainy. By under cooking the pasta and using a high fat dairy blend, we achieve a decadent finish that holds up perfectly under a buttery cracker crust.
  • Time: Active 15 mins, Passive 30 mins, Total 45 mins
  • Flavor/Texture Hook: Silky sharp cheddar sauce with a buttery, shattering cracker topping
  • Perfect for: Family Sunday dinners, holiday sides, or ultimate comfort food cravings
Make-ahead: Assemble fully, cover tightly, and refrigerate up to 24 hours before baking.

Science of the Velvet Sauce

Understanding the "why" makes you a better cook than any recipe ever could. When we make this dish, we are essentially managing three different physical states: a solid (pasta), a liquid (milk/cream), and an emulsion (the cheese sauce). If any of these go out of balance, the texture fails.

  • Starch Gelatinization: When we whisk flour into melted butter, we’re coating starch granules in fat so they don't clump. Once the milk hits 175°F (80°C), those starches swell and trap the liquid, creating the thick base.
  • Emulsification Stability: Cheese is a mix of fat, water, and protein. If you heat it too fast or use pre shredded cheese with cellulose (anti clumping agents), the proteins tighten and squeeze out the fat, leading to that dreaded oily pool.
  • Pasta Rehydration: Since we bake the dish, the macaroni acts like a sponge. We par boil it to 2 minutes under al dente because it will absorb another 10% of its weight in cheese sauce while in the oven.
  • The Maillard Reaction: The Ritz cracker topping contains sugars and fats that brown quickly at 400°F (200°C), providing a toasted, savory contrast to the creamy interior.
FeatureStovetop MethodOven Baked Method
TextureLoose and saucyThick and set
Top LayerNoneCrispy cracker or cheese crust
Best ForQuick kids' lunchHoliday dinners/Casseroles
Prep Time15 minutes45 minutes

Stovetop versions are great for a quick fix, but they lack the structural integrity of a baked dish. In the oven, the sauce reduces slightly, concentrating the flavors and allowing the top layer to develop that essential crunch. This version is designed to be sliced into hearty portions that stay together on the plate.

Planning Your Recipe Specs

Before you start boiling water, let's look at what we're working with. This recipe makes 8 generous servings, which is usually enough for my family plus a little leftover for "cold mac" breakfast (don't judge me until you try it).

If you're hosting a smaller group, you can easily halve this, but I find that people always go back for thirds anyway.

ComponentRoleScience/Pro Secret
Elbow MacaroniThe VesselIts hollow shape acts like a pipe, holding the cheese sauce inside and out.
Sharp CheddarFlavor BaseAged cheddar has less moisture and more "bite," but needs Gruyere to help it melt smoothly.
Dry MustardFlavor BoosterMustard is an emulsifier that also cuts through the heavy fat of the dairy.
Heavy CreamTexture ProviderThe extra fat prevents the sauce from breaking under high oven heat.

Always use a 9x13 inch baking dish for this quantity. If your dish is too small, the sauce will bubble over the sides and burn on the bottom of your oven. If it's too large, the sauce will spread too thin and evaporate, leaving you with dry noodles. Balance is everything here.

Ingredient Deep Dive Analysis

We need to talk about the cheese. I know it’s a workout, but you have to grate it yourself. Pre shredded cheese is coated in potato starch or cellulose to keep the shreds from sticking together in the bag. That starch prevents the cheese from melting into a cohesive sauce, leaving you with a "gritty" mouthfeel.

  • 1 lb elbow macaroni: Why this? The classic shape provides the best surface area to sauce ratio for a consistent bite.
  • 1/2 cup unsalted butter: Why this? Used for the roux and topping; unsalted allows you to control the seasoning.
  • 1/2 cup all purpose flour: Why this? The structural thickening agent for our mornay sauce.
  • 3 cups whole milk: Why this? Provides the volume for the sauce without being too heavy.
  • 1 cup heavy cream: Why this? Adds stability and a luxurious, silky finish to the cheese blend.
  • 4 cups sharp cheddar: Why this? Provides the iconic "mac" flavor profile and orange hue.
  • 2 cups Gruyere cheese: Why this? A superior melting cheese that adds a nutty, sophisticated undertone.
  • 1 tsp dry mustard powder: Why this? Elevates the sharp notes of the cheddar without adding moisture.
  • 1/2 tsp smoked paprika: Why this? Adds a subtle woodsy depth and a hint of color.
  • 1/4 tsp ground nutmeg: Why this? The "secret" ingredient that makes white sauces taste professional.
  • 1 cup Ritz crackers: Why this? They provide a buttery, salty crunch that breadcrumbs can't match.
  • 1/2 cup extra sharp cheddar: Why this? Reserved for the very top to create those crispy cheese edges.
Original IngredientSubstituteWhy It Works
Gruyere (2 cups)Fontina or GoudaBoth are excellent melters with mild, creamy flavors.
Ritz Crackers (1 cup)Panko BreadcrumbsProvides a lighter, airier crunch. Note: Needs extra butter to brown well.
Whole Milk (3 cups)2% MilkSlightly less creamy, but the heavy cream will compensate for the fat loss.

If you decide to swap the cheese, just make sure you keep the ratio of "flavor cheese" to "melting cheese" the same. Cheddar is for flavor; Gruyere, Fontina, or Monterey Jack are for the "stretch" and smoothness. Mixing them is what creates that high end restaurant quality at home.

Essential Tools for Success

You don't need a professional kitchen, but a few specific tools will make your life significantly easier. First, a heavy bottomed saucepan or Dutch oven is vital for the sauce. Thin pans have "hot spots" that can scorch the milk or burn the roux before you even get started.

A balloon whisk is your best friend here. It helps incorporate the flour into the butter and ensures no lumps of flour remain when you start adding the liquid. For the baking, a standard glass or ceramic 9x13 dish is the gold standard.

These materials retain heat well, which helps the edges get that slightly chewy, caramelized cheese crust that everyone fights over.

Chef's Tip: Use a box grater with large holes for the cheese. If you have a food processor with a grating attachment, use it! It saves 10 minutes and your knuckles will thank you.

step-by-step Cooking Flow

Creamy mac and cheese served in a white bowl, topped with browned breadcrumbs and fresh parsley.

Let’s get into the rhythm. This recipe moves fast once the sauce starts thickening, so have all your cheese grated and your spices measured before you turn on the stove. This is a great dish to serve alongside a Classic Meatloaf Recipe for the ultimate comfort meal.

  1. Boil the pasta. Cook the macaroni in salted water for exactly 2 minutes less than the package's al dente instructions. Drain and set aside.Note: It should be firm to the bite as it will finish cooking in the sauce.
  2. Create the roux. In a large pot, melt 1/2 cup butter over medium heat. Whisk in the flour and cook for 2 minutes until it smells slightly nutty and looks like pale sand.
  3. Incorporate the dairy. Slowly stream in the milk and heavy cream, whisking constantly. Simmer 5-7 minutes until thick enough to coat a spoon.
  4. Season the base. Whisk in the mustard powder, smoked paprika, nutmeg, and sea salt. Note: Nutmeg is powerful; don't overdo it!
  5. Melt the cheese. Remove the pot from heat and stir in the 4 cups of cheddar and 2 cups of Gruyere. Whisk until the sauce is completely smooth and velvety.
  6. Combine. Add the cooked macaroni to the cheese sauce. Fold gently until every noodle is submerged in liquid gold.
  7. Transfer. Pour the mixture into a greased 9x13 baking dish. Note: It may look too saucy, but the pasta will absorb the excess in the oven.
  8. Prepare the topping. Toss crushed Ritz crackers with 2 tbsp melted butter and the remaining 1/2 cup of extra sharp cheddar.
  9. Garnish and bake. Sprinkle the topping over the macaroni. Bake at 350°F (180°C) for 30 minutes until the edges are bubbling and the top is deep golden brown.
  10. Rest. Let the dish sit for 10 minutes before serving. This allows the sauce to set so it isn't runny.

Troubleshooting Your Cheese Sauce

Even the best cooks run into trouble with cheese sauces. The most common heartbreak is "breaking," which is when the fat separates from the solids, leaving you with an oily mess and a gritty clump of cheese. This usually happens because the heat was too high when the cheese was added.

Why Your Sauce Turned Gritty

Grittiness usually comes from two sources: pre shredded cheese or overheating. If you use bagged cheese, the cellulose won't melt. If the sauce is boiling when you add the cheese, the proteins in the dairy will tighten up and grain. Always take the pot off the heat before stirring in your cheese.

Why Your Macaroni is Dry

If you find your baked version is a bit parched, you likely overcooked the pasta during the boiling stage or didn't use enough liquid. The pasta keeps drinking the sauce while it bakes. If you like it extra "soupy," you can increase the milk by another 1/2 cup next time.

ProblemRoot CauseSolution
Oily SauceHigh heat or cheap cheeseRemove from heat before adding cheese; use high-quality blocks.
Lumpy BaseMilk added too fastAdd milk 1/2 cup at a time, whisking until smooth before adding more.
Bland FlavorLack of acidity/saltAdd an extra pinch of salt or a teaspoon of Dijon mustard.

Common Mistakes Checklist: ✓ Grate your own cheese to avoid the gritty texture of anti caking agents. ✓ Stop boiling the pasta 2 minutes early so it doesn't turn to mush in the oven.

✓ Keep the milk and cream at room temperature (or warm them) to prevent the roux from seizing. ✓ Never skip the resting period after baking; it’s essential for the sauce to thicken. ✓ Use a heavy bottomed pot to ensure even heat distribution for the roux.

Customizing Flavors and Textures

One of the best things about this recipe is how much you can play with it. While my kids love the classic cheddar heavy version, you can easily shift the flavor profile by changing the cheese or adding "mix ins." Just keep the total volume of cheese at 6.5 cups to maintain the sauce ratio.

For a smoky kick, swap the Gruyere for Smoked Gouda and add some chopped, crispy bacon to the mix. If you want a bit of heat, use Pepper Jack for half of the cheddar and throw in some diced jalapeños. To make it a full meal, stir in some shredded rotisserie chicken or steamed broccoli florets before baking.

If you are scaling the recipe down for two people, use a smaller 8x8 dish and reduce the baking time by about 5 to 8 minutes. When scaling up for a crowd (doubling the recipe), keep the spice levels at about 1.5x rather than a full 2x, as things like nutmeg and mustard powder can become overwhelming in large batches.

Storage and Leftover Tips

Leftover macaroni and cheese is a gift. It stays fresh in the fridge for up to 4 days if kept in an airtight container. When you're ready to eat it again, don't just microwave it on high, or the cheese will get oily. Add a splash of milk or a tiny knob of butter, cover it, and heat it gently on medium power.

This helps re emulsify the sauce.

For freezing, this dish is a superstar. You can freeze it before or after baking. If freezing before baking, let it cool completely, wrap it twice in foil, and it will keep for up to 3 months. Bake it directly from frozen at 350°F (180°C) for about 60 minutes.

Zero Waste Tip: If you have leftover Ritz cracker crumbs that didn't make it onto the dish, don't toss them! They make an incredible breading for chicken cutlets or a crunchy topping for a vegetable gratin. You can even serve a scoop of this mac alongside some Baked Salmon in recipe for a fancy meets comfort dinner plate.

Serving and Plating Ideas

Presentation is the final touch that makes people go "wow." While you can certainly serve this straight from the baking dish, I love using a cast iron skillet for that rustic, farmhouse look. If you do use cast iron, the edges will get extra crispy my favorite part!

Garnish with a sprinkle of fresh parsley or chives right before serving. The green pop of color cuts through all that yellow and orange, making the dish look fresh rather than heavy.

If you're serving this at a party, consider making "Mac Bites" by baking the mixture in greased muffin tins for 20 minutes. It creates individual portions with 360 degrees of crispy edges.

The most important thing to remember is the rest time. I know it's hard when the whole house smells like cheese, but those 10 minutes allow the starches to settle. If you scoop too early, the sauce will run to the bottom of the plate.

Wait a few minutes, and you'll get that perfect, creamy "pull" that every great mac and cheese deserves. Enjoy every buttery, cheesy bite!

Close-up shot showing the creamy, cheesy texture of baked macaroni and cheese with crunchy toasted breadcrumb topping.

HIGH in Sodium

⚠️

1045 mg mg of sodium per serving (45% % of daily value)

The American Heart Association recommends limiting sodium intake to about 2,300mg per day.

Tips to Reduce Sodium in Your Mac and Cheese

  • 🧀Reduce Cheese Sodium-20%

    Swap some of the sharp cheddar (4 cups) and Gruyere cheese (2 cups) with a low-sodium mozzarella cheese (use 2 cups mozzarella, 1 cup cheddar, 1 cup Gruyere). This simple swap can significantly reduce the overall sodium content, as cheddar and Gruyere cheeses are naturally high in sodium.

    Be sure to check the label.

  • 🧂Reduce Added Salt-15%

    Eliminate the 1 tbsp of sea salt added to the pasta water. The cheeses already contribute a significant amount of sodium. You can compensate for the flavor with other spices. You can also reduce sodium by using a low-sodium pasta. Taste before adding any additional salt at the end.

  • 🧈Unsalted Topping-10%

    Ensure the crushed Ritz cracker topping is made with unsalted butter (which you already are) and consider using a low-sodium cracker alternative or a homemade breadcrumb topping with no added salt. You can also omit the topping altogether. Be sure to read the labels.

  • 🥛Lower Sodium Milk Alternative-5%

    Consider using low-sodium milk in the recipe. Using unsalted butter and low-sodium milk will reduce your sodium intake. Be sure to read the labels.

  • 🌿Spice It Up!

    Experiment with herbs and spices like black pepper, garlic powder, onion powder, or a pinch of cayenne pepper to enhance the flavor of your mac and cheese without adding sodium. These additions contribute flavor complexity.

Estimated Reduction: Up to 50% less sodium (approximately 522 mg per serving)

Recipe FAQs

How long should you cook mac and cheese in the oven?

Bake for 30 minutes. This time allows the sauce to fully set around the par-boiled noodles and the topping to achieve a deep golden brown crisp.

What are the three best cheeses for mac and cheese baked?

Sharp Cheddar, Gruyère, and a third sharp/melting cheese like Monterey Jack. Sharp Cheddar provides the iconic flavor, Gruyère adds nutty complexity and superior melt quality, and the third cheese ensures a stable, stretchy sauce.

Should I boil macaroni before baking?

Yes, you must par-boil the macaroni first. Cook the pasta for 2 minutes shy of package al dente instructions, as the noodles will absorb significant moisture from the sauce while finishing in the oven.

How to bake mac and cheese?

Combine the sauced pasta with the topping and bake at 350°F (180°C) for 30 minutes. Ensure your roux base is perfectly smooth off the heat before adding the cheese, and always let the final dish rest for 10 minutes after removal from the oven.

What is the secret to a creamy, non-gritty baked mac and cheese sauce?

Remove the sauce from the heat completely before incorporating the shredded cheese. High heat causes the proteins in the cheese to seize and release fat, resulting in graininess; taking it off the burner ensures a silky, stable emulsion.

Is it true I must use block cheese instead of pre-shredded?

Yes, block cheese is non-negotiable for the best texture. Pre-shredded varieties contain starches, like cellulose, to prevent clumping, which prevents the cheese from fully melting into the sauce.

Can I use a different topping besides crackers?

Absolutely; the goal is texture contrast. While Ritz crackers offer a buttery crunch, you can achieve similar results with Panko breadcrumbs mixed with melted butter. If you are mastering the technique of creating a crisp exterior, you'll see how that same principle applies to achieving a perfect crust on your Air Fryer Chicken recipe.

Creamy Baked Macaroni

Baked Macaroni and Cheese with Breadcrumbs Recipe Card
Baked Macaroni and Cheese with Breadcrumbs Recipe Card
0.0 / 5 (0 Review)
Preparation time:15 Mins
Cooking time:30 Mins
Servings:8 servings

Ingredients:

Instructions:

Nutrition Facts:

Calories935 kcal
Protein36.1 g
Fat61.1 g
Carbs59.6 g
Fiber2.1 g
Sugar6.4 g
Sodium1045 mg

Recipe Info:

CategorySide Dish
CuisineAmerican
Share, Rating and Comments:
Submit Review:
Rating Breakdown
5
(0)
4
(0)
3
(0)
2
(0)
1
(0)
Recipe Comments: